Frequently asked questions
How many UK universities offer Medicine courses?
1623 UK university courses in Medicine are listed in UniversityDB.
What is the average graduate salary for Medicine in the UK?
Graduates of UK Medicine courses earn a median salary of £27,500 (interquartile range £25,500–£28,500), based on 654 courses with published salary data.
What percentage of UK Medicine graduates are in work or further study?
87% of UK Medicine graduates are in work or further study 15 months after graduating, based on Discover Uni outcomes data from 486 courses.
Which UK university offers the most Medicine courses?
University of Manchester in Manchester offers the most Medicine courses in this list (84 courses).
